WebThe respiratory system is evaluated by counting respirations over a full minute because breathing in neonates is irregular; normal rate is 40 to 60 breaths/minute. The chest wall should be examined for symmetry, and lung sounds should be equal throughout. Grunting, nasal flaring, and retractions are signs of respiratory distress . Thrombocytopenia signs and symptoms may include: Easy or excessive bruising (purpura) Superficial bleeding into the skin that appears as a rash of pinpoint-sized reddish-purple spots (petechiae), usually on the lower legs. Prolonged bleeding from cuts. Bleeding from your gums or nose. Web25. máj 2024 · Pinpoint areas (less than 2 mm) of hemorrhage, which are reddish-purple lesions are called petechiae ( picture 1 ), while larger confluent lesions are referred to as ecchymoses ( picture 2 ). Ecchymoses are commonly called bruises. In some cases, ecchymoses may be tender or raised.
